According to xtelligent Healthtech Analytics, a new study published in PLOS Digital Health evaluated all 1,357 AI and machine learning-enabled medical devices cleared by the FDA through December 5, 2025.

Here is what the researchers found:

🔹 Only 34 devices (2.5%) were linked to registered prospective trials
🔹 Only 12 (0.9%) posted results from those trials
🔹 Only 12 (0.9%) progressed to peer-reviewed publication
🔹 Only 3 devices (0.2%) were evaluated for patient-centered outcomes like mortality, morbidity, or readmissions

And the radiology-specific number is the one I cannot stop thinking about.

Radiology accounts for 78% of cleared devices. But only 1% of those devices were linked to prospective trials.

That is not a gap. That is a canyon.

Now layer in the funding reality. Of the 34 trials that did exist, 32 of them (94%) were industry-sponsored. The study authors called it directly: the evidence base is “incomplete, systematically biased, and tilted toward optimism.”

The 510(k) pathway, which cleared the vast majority of these devices, only requires “substantial equivalence” to an existing tool. It does not require any vendor to prove the tool actually helps patients. That is a structural problem, not a vendor problem.

And here is what most people are missing: accuracy metrics and patient outcomes are not the same thing. A model can be 95% accurate on a benchmark and still fail to move the needle on mortality. We have been measuring the wrong thing and calling it proof.

The study authors made three specific recommendations:

🔹 The FDA should mandate pre-registration of prospective trials for all Class II and III AI devices before clearance
🔹 Devices should be validated in the populations where they will actually be used
🔹 CMS and other insurers should link reimbursement to demonstrated clinical benefit

That last one is the unlock. Reimbursement tied to outcomes changes the incentive structure completely.
